Πώς να αποθηκεύσετε ένα γράφημα Excel ως εικόνα (αποθήκευση ως PNG, JPG, BMP)

Πώς να αποθηκεύσετε ένα γράφημα Excel ως εικόνα (αποθήκευση ως PNG, JPG, BMP)

Το Excel έχει πολλά χρήσιμα ενσωματωμένα γραφήματα και μπορείτε επίσης να συνδυάσετε και να δημιουργήσετε μερικά καταπληκτικά συνδυαστικά γραφήματα.Τα γραφήματα του Excel είναι ένας πολύ καλός τρόπος οπτικοποίησης δεδομένων και χρησιμοποιούνται συχνά όταν πρέπει να τα παρουσιάσετε στον διευθυντή/πελάτη σας.

Αν και τα γραφήματα σας μπορεί να είναι στο Excel, αυτός δεν είναι ο καλύτερος τρόπος για να τα παρουσιάσετε στους πελάτες/διαχειριστές σας.Συνήθως, αυτά τα διαγράμματα πρέπει να εμφανίζονται σε παρουσιάσεις PowerPoint ή έγγραφα PDF MS Word.

Θα ήταν ωραίο αν ήταν ενσωματωμένες δυνατότητες για να αποθηκεύονται τα γραφήματα του Excel ως εικόνες, αλλά αυτό δεν συμβαίνει.

Ωστόσο, υπάρχουν τρόποι για εύκολη αποθήκευση και εξαγωγή γραφημάτων στο Excel ως εικόνες (τα JPG, PNG, BMP είναι μερικά δημοφιλή) και σε αυτό το σεμινάριο, θα καλύψω αυτές τις μεθόδους.

Η μέθοδος που χρησιμοποιώ εξαρτάται από το πόσα γραφήματα έχετε.Εάν έχετε μόνο μερικά γραφήματα που θέλετε να αποθηκεύσετε ως εικόνες, μπορείτε να χρησιμοποιήσετε τη μέθοδο αντιγραφής-επικόλλησης, αλλά αν έχετε πολλά, είναι προτιμότερο να χρησιμοποιήσετε τη μέθοδο "λήψη ως HTML" ή VBA.

Αντιγραφή διαγράμματος ως αποθήκευση ως εικόνα (MS Paint ή άλλο εργαλείο γραφικών)

Μια πολύ συνηθισμένη μέθοδος που βλέπω ότι χρησιμοποιούν πολλοί άνθρωποι είναι να τραβούν ένα στιγμιότυπο οθόνης ολόκληρης της οθόνης (αυτό μπορεί να γίνει πατώντας το πλήκτρο PrintScreen).Μόλις το κάνετε αυτό, μπορείτε να ανοίξετε το MS Paint (ή οποιοδήποτε εργαλείο χρησιμοποιείτε), να επικολλήσετε το στιγμιότυπο οθόνης και να διαγράψετε οτιδήποτε άλλο και να διατηρήσετε την εικόνα.

Αν και αυτός είναι ένας πολύ καλός τρόπος για να αποθηκεύσετε το διάγραμμα ως εικόνα και λειτουργεί καλά, υπάρχει καλύτερος τρόπος (που απαιτεί λιγότερο χρόνο και η εικόνα είναι πιο ακριβής).

Ας υποθέσουμε ότι έχετε ένα αρχείο Excel με ένα γράφημα όπως αυτό:

Διαγράμματα που πρέπει να αποθηκευτούν ως εικόνες

Ακολουθούν τα βήματα για να αποθηκεύσετε αυτό το γράφημα/γραφικό ως εικόνα:

  1. Κάντε δεξί κλικ στο γράφημα για αποθήκευση
  2. Κάντε κλικ για αντιγραφήΚάντε κλικ για αντιγραφή γραφήματος
  3. Ανοίξτε το MS Paint (ή οποιοδήποτε εργαλείο χρησιμοποιείτε)
  4. Επικολλήστε την εικόνα (Control V για MS Paint)Επικόλληση διαγραμμάτων στο MS Paint
  5. Εάν υπάρχει επιπλέον λευκό κενό, απλώς επιλέξτε και σύρετέ το ώστε να έχετε μόνο το γράφημα
  6. Κάντε κλικ στην καρτέλα ΑρχείοΚάντε κλικ στην καρτέλα Αρχείο στο MS Paint
  7. πηγαίνετε για αποθήκευση ως
  8. Κάντε κλικ στη μορφή εικόνας (JPG, PNG και BMP) στην οποία θα αποθηκεύσετε το γράφημα.Αποθηκεύστε το γράφημα ως εικόνα PNG

Το πλεονέκτημα αυτής της μεθόδου έναντι των στιγμιότυπων οθόνης είναι ότι αυτή η μέθοδος αντιγράφει μόνο το γράφημα, πρέπει να προσαρμόσετε το κενό διάστημα μία φορά στο MS Paint (αν χρησιμοποιείτε οποιοδήποτε άλλο εργαλείο γραφικών, πιθανότατα δεν το κάνετε).

Εάν έχετε ήδη δύο ή περισσότερες ρυθμίσεις γραφημάτων στο Excel και θέλετε να αποθηκεύσετε ολόκληρη τη διάταξη ως εικόνα, μπορείτε να το κάνετε επιλέγοντας όλα αυτά τα γραφήματα, αντιγράφοντας τα και επικολλώντας τα στο MS Paint.

Σχετικές ερωτήσεις  Επαναφορά ιστορικού αρχείων Windows 10: Ανάκτηση διαγραμμένων αρχείων

Αποθηκεύστε όλα τα γραφήματα σε ένα βιβλίο εργασίας ως εικόνες ταυτόχρονα

Εάν έχετε ένα βιβλίο εργασίας με πολλά γραφήματα και θέλετε να τα αποθηκεύσετε όλα ταυτόχρονα, ο καλύτερος τρόπος είναι να αποθηκεύσετε το βιβλίο εργασίας του Excel ως αρχείο HTML.

Όταν το κάνετε αυτό, όλα τα γραφήματα στο βιβλίο εργασίας του Excel θα είναιστον ληφθέν φάκελοΟι εικόνες αποθηκεύονται σε μορφή PNG.

Ας υποθέσουμε ότι έχετε ένα βιβλίο εργασίας του Excel που περιέχει πολλά φύλλα εργασίας με γραφήματα.

Ακολουθούν τα βήματα για να αποθηκεύσετε το αρχείο ως HTML και το γράφημα Excel ως εικόνα σε μορφή PNG:

  1. Ανοίξτε ένα βιβλίο εργασίας που περιέχει ένα γράφημα
  2. Κάντε κλικ στην καρτέλα ΑρχείοΚάντε κλικ στην καρτέλα Αρχείο στην κορδέλα του Excel
  3. Κάντε κλικ στην επιλογή Αποθήκευση ωςΚάντε κλικ στην επιλογή Αποθήκευση ως
  4. Κάντε κλικ στην Αναζήτηση και επιλέξτε τη θέση όπου θέλετε να αποθηκεύσετε όλες τις εικόνες γραφήματοςκάντε κλικ για περιήγηση
  5. Αλλάξτε την επιλογή "Αποθήκευση ως τύπος" σε Ιστοσελίδα (*.htm, *.html)Αποθήκευση ως ιστοσελίδα HTM ή HTML
  6. κάντε κλικ στην αποθήκευση

Αυτό θα αποθηκεύσει το αρχείο Excel ως ιστοσελίδα στον καθορισμένο φάκελο.

Τώρα για να λάβετε όλα τα γραφήματα ως εικόνες, μεταβείτε στο φάκελο και θα βρείτε έναν φάκελο με το όνομα Filename_files (όπου Όνομα αρχείου είναι το όνομα που δώσατε στο αρχείο όταν το αποθηκεύσατε).

Όταν ανοίξετε αυτόν τον φάκελο, θα βρείτε όλα τα διαγράμματα που έχουν αποθηκευτεί ως εικόνες PNG.

Το αρχείο Excel αποθηκεύτηκε ως ιστοσελίδα HTML

注意: Όταν το δοκίμασα στο σύστημά μου, έδωσε δύο εικόνες (ίδιες) για κάθε γράφημα.Έτσι, εάν έχετε τέσσερα διαγράμματα, θα σας δώσει οκτώ εικόνες.

注意: Πριν αποθηκεύσετε το αρχείο Excel ως HTML, φροντίστε να αποθηκεύσετε ένα αντίγραφο ασφαλείας.Επίσης, όταν αποθηκεύετε ένα αρχείο ως HTML, το τρέχον ανοιχτό αρχείο είναι πλέον αρχείο HTML και όχι αρχείο μορφής Excel.Αφού αποθηκεύσετε το αρχείο, θα πρέπει να κλείσετε το τρέχον αρχείο (τώρα το αρχείο HTML) και να ανοίξετε την έκδοση του Excel (γι' αυτό είναι σημαντικά τα αντίγραφα ασφαλείας)

Αποθηκεύστε όλα τα γραφήματα ως εικόνες χρησιμοποιώντας VBA

Μπορείτε επίσης να αποθηκεύσετε γρήγορα ένα γράφημα από ένα βιβλίο εργασίας του Excel σε έναν συγκεκριμένο φάκελο χρησιμοποιώντας κώδικα VBA.

Εάν χρειάζεται απλώς να αποθηκεύσετε το ενεργό γράφημα (το γράφημα της επιλογής σας) σε έναν συγκεκριμένο φάκελο, μπορείτε να χρησιμοποιήσετε τον ακόλουθο κώδικα VBA:

ActiveChart.Export ":UserssumitDesktopExampleChartName.png"

Ο παραπάνω κώδικας θα αποθηκεύσει το ενεργό γράφημα σε μορφή PNG στον φάκελο Example με το όνομα ChartName.Μπορείτε να αλλάξετε το όνομα του γραφήματος και το όνομα/την τοποθεσία του φακέλου, όπως απαιτείται.

Εάν θέλετε να αποθηκεύσετε την εικόνα/εικόνα σε μορφή JPG, μπορείτε να χρησιμοποιήσετε τον ακόλουθο κώδικα:

ActiveChart.Export ":UserssumitDesktopExampleChartName.jpg"

Μπορείτε να εκτελέσετε αυτόν τον κώδικα VBA τοποθετώντας τον στο Άμεσο Παράθυρο, τοποθετώντας τον κέρσορα στο τέλος της γραμμής και πατώντας Enter (ή μπορείτε να βάλετε μια κανονική μονάδα και να εκτελέσετε τον κώδικα από εκεί).

Σχετικές ερωτήσεις  Πώς να σταματήσετε τον συγχρονισμό των Φωτογραφιών Google;

Ωστόσο, εάν έχετε πολλά γραφήματα, αυτή η μέθοδος θα πάρει αρκετό χρόνο.Σε αυτήν την περίπτωση, μπορείτε να χρησιμοποιήσετε τον ελαφρώς μεγαλύτερο κώδικα VBA που αναφέρεται παρακάτω:

Sub SaveChartsasImages()
Dim i ως ακέραιο
Dim CurrentActiveSheet ως φύλλο εργασίας

Application.ScreenUpdating = False
Application.EnableEvents = False

Ορισμός CurrentActiveSheet = ActiveSheet

Για κάθε Sht Σε Φύλλα Εργασίας
Για κάθε cht Στο ActiveSheet.ChartObjects
cht.Ενεργοποίηση
i = i + 1
ActiveChart.Export "C:\Users\sumit\Desktop\Example\" & Sht.Name & "_chart" & i & ".png"
Επόμενο cht
Επόμενος Στ

CurrentActiveSheet.Ενεργοποίηση

Application.ScreenUpdating = True
Application.EnableEvents = True

Sub End

Ο παραπάνω κώδικας επαναλαμβάνεται σε κάθε φύλλο του βιβλίου εργασίας και στη συνέχεια μπαίνει σε κάθε γράφημα σε κάθε φύλλο.Στη συνέχεια επιλέγει το γράφημα και το αποθηκεύει στον καθορισμένο φάκελο.

Όλοι αυτοί οι βρόχοι γίνονται χρησιμοποιώντας τον βρόχο Για κάθε επόμενο.

Επιπλέον, το γράφημα αποθηκεύεται στη μορφή ονόματος φύλλου εργασίαςname_chartNumber.Αυτό θα διασφαλίσει ότι μπορείτε να προσδιορίσετε ποιο γράφημα ανήκει σε ποιο φύλλο.

Ένα άλλο πλεονέκτημα της χρήσης VBA είναι ότι μπορείτε να προσαρμόσετε τον κώδικα ώστε να αποθηκεύεται το γράφημα μόνο ως εικόνα από ορισμένα συγκεκριμένα φύλλα εργασίας.Για παράδειγμα, εάν θέλετε να αποθηκεύσετε γραφήματα μόνο από φύλλα εργασίας με το πρόθεμα 2020, μπορείτε να τροποποιήσετε τον κώδικα για να το κάνετε (αυτό μπορεί να γίνει χρησιμοποιώντας τη δήλωση IF THEN ELSE μετά τη γραμμή βρόχου FOR)

Αντιγράψτε και επικολλήστε γραφήματα Excel ως εικόνες σε MS Word ή PowerPoint

Στις περισσότερες περιπτώσεις, πρέπει να παρουσιάσετε τα διαγράμματα σας σε έγγραφα MS Word ή PowerPoint.Αυτό συμβαίνει συνήθως εάν δημιουργείτε μια αναφορά ή ένα έγγραφο πελάτη.

Σχετικές ερωτήσεις  Η καλύτερη κατάργηση κακόβουλου λογισμικού και προστασία ransomware

Ακριβώς όπως μπορείτε να αντιγράψετε και να επικολλήσετε εικόνες στο MS Paint, μπορείτε να κάνετε το ίδιο με το Word ή το PowerPoint.

Υπάρχει όμως μια διαφορά...

Όταν αντιγράφετε ένα γράφημα/γράφημα στο Excel και το επικολλάτε σε MS Word ή MS PowerPoint, δεν θα επικολληθεί ως εικόνα.Στην πραγματικότητα έχει επικολληθεί ως "Αντικείμενο γραφικών του Microsoft Office"

Αυτή η επιλογή είναι χρήσιμη για όσους θέλουν να διατηρήσουν το γράφημα ακόμη και σε MS Word ή PowerPoint, ώστε να μπορείτε να το επεξεργαστείτε και να το μορφοποιήσετε ως γράφημα.Επιπλέον, αυτό το είδος γραφήματος εξακολουθεί να είναι συνδεδεμένο με τα δεδομένα στο Excel και όταν ενημερώνετε τα δεδομένα στο παρασκήνιο, το επικολλημένο γράφημα θα ενημερωθεί επίσης ανάλογα.

Ωστόσο, εάν θέλετε να επικολλήσετε αυτό το διάγραμμα ως εικόνα, δείτε πώς να το κάνετε (σε αυτό το παράδειγμα, θα χρησιμοποιήσω το MS Word για να δείξω τα βήματα και το ίδιο ισχύει για το PowerPoint):

  1. Επιλέξτε το γράφημα για αντιγραφή στο MS Word
  2. Κάντε δεξί κλικ και κάντε κλικ στην ΑντιγραφήΚάντε κλικ για αντιγραφή γραφήματος
  3. Ανοίξτε το έγγραφο MS Word όπου θέλετε να επικολλήσετε αυτό το διάγραμμα ως εικόνα
  4. Στην κατηγορία Πρόχειρο της καρτέλας Αρχική, κάντε κλικ στο εικονίδιο Επικόλληση (η ενότητα με το κάτω βέλος).Κάντε κλικ στην επιλογή Επικόλληση στην αρχική καρτέλα
  5. Στις επιλογές που εμφανίζονται, κάντε κλικ στην επιλογή Επικόλληση ως εικόναΕπικολλήστε το διάγραμμα ως εικόνα

Τα παραπάνω βήματα θα διασφαλίσουν ότι το διάγραμμα επικολλάται ως εικόνα.

Εάν κάνετε απλώς κλικ στο κουμπί επικόλλησης (αντί επικόλλησης ως εικόνα), το γραφικό δεν θα επικολληθεί ως εικόνα.

Επομένως, μπορείτε να αποθηκεύσετε γρήγορα γραφήματα στο Excel ως εικόνες με τους ακόλουθους τέσσερις τρόπους.Ορισμένες μέθοδοι σας επιτρέπουν επίσης να επιλέξετε τη μορφή της εικόνας (π.χ. χρησιμοποιώντας MS Paint ή VBA).

Εάν έχετε μόνο λίγα γραφήματα, μπορείτε να χρησιμοποιήσετε τη μέθοδο MS Paint, αλλά εάν θέλετε να αποθηκεύσετε πολλά γραφήματα σε φύλλα εργασίας, είναι προτιμότερο να χρησιμοποιήσετε τη μέθοδο HTML ή τον κώδικα VBA.Εάν ο απώτερος στόχος είναι να εισαγάγετε αυτά τα γραφήματα στο Word ή το PowerPoint, είναι καλύτερο να αντιγράψετε και να επικολλήσετε τα γραφήματα απευθείας ως εικόνες σε αυτά τα άλλα εργαλεία.

Ελπίζω να βρήκατε αυτό το σεμινάριο χρήσιμο.

Γεια σου 👋Χαίρομαι που σε γνωρίζω.

Εγγραφείτε στο ενημερωτικό μας δελτίο, Αποστολή πολύ τακτικάΜεγάλη τεχνολογίαΣτην ανάρτησή σου.

Δημοσίευση σχολίου